Notes for Hans Jacob Brodbeck:
NOTES: Baptized Dec 12, 1697.
Hans Jacob was a linen weaver at Muttenz and was probably
still living when his son, Adam, left for America in 1748. When his wife,
Anna, died in 1747 she was identified as the wife of the linen
weaver and Adam was identified as his son in the records concerning his
emigration. Hans Jacob was not referred to as deceased in either record.
No death record for him can be found at Muttenz. It is strange that
Hans Jacob remained at Muttenz after his son left, since his wife was
deceased and he had no other children. (Source: Vol 1 of " From the Rhine
to the Shenandoah" by Daniel Bly).

Notes for Christian Meyer:
Notes
From Tom Kirkpatrick
IMMIGRATION: Meyer (Mayer) family fled Palatinate to Holland due to religious persecution
and to America Abt 1700 with entire family; In 1710 setlled at Livingston Manor NY in Schoharie
Valley near the Hudson River. In Abt 1711 migrated to PA, possibly down Schuylkill River to
Perkiomen Creek, where a Christian Miers owned land next to Bishop Henry Funk. Finally settled
at Indian Creek, Franconia Twp, Philadelphia Co (now Montgomery Co), PA. In 1731 Christian
Meyer was granted patent by John Thomas & Richard Penn (sons of William Penn)

SOURCE: Richard & Kathryn Hott, Hott Ancestors; 1710-1984; Adelphi, MD, Richard D. Hott,
10423 Oakhill Ct, Adelphi, MD 20783. James Y. Heckler, THe History of Lower Salford
Township, 1888 and George Wheeler, "Richard Penn's Manor of Andolhea" as cited in Frances
Funk, Joseph Funk A Biography, Pub 1984, Frances Funk, HC72, Box 557, Lake of the Woods,
Locust Grove, VA 22508. Approximate birthdate from Ancestral File Source BXMV-JK.
